2. Akụrụngwa nwụnye
- Gbanyụọ ma wepụ njikọ: Shut down your computer completely and unplug the power cord from the wall outlet.
- Okwu mepere emepe: Wepu akụkụ akụkụ nke ikpe kọmputa gị iji nweta motherboard.
- Chọta oghere PCIe: Identify an available PCI Express x16 slot on your motherboard. This is typically the longest slot.
- Wepụ mkpuchi oghere: Remove the metal slot cover(s) from the back of your computer case corresponding to the PCIe slot you will use.
- Fanye kaadị eserese: Carefully align the graphics card with the PCIe slot. Press down firmly and evenly on both ends of the card until it is fully seated in the slot. You should hear a click from the retention clip.
- Kaadị echedoro: Secure the graphics card to the computer case using the screw(s) removed from the slot cover(s).
- Jikọọ Ike (ọ bụrụ na ọdabara): If your graphics card requires additional power, connect the appropriate PCIe power cables from your PSU to the graphics card. This model (NVIDIA 699-51030-0501-101) may not require external power, but always check the card itself for connectors.
- Mechie Ikpe: Dochie akụkụ akụkụ nke akpa kọmputa gị.
- Reconnect Peripherals: Reconnect your monitor cable to one of the display outputs on the new graphics card. Reconnect all other peripherals and the power cord.

Nchọpụta nsogbu
Ọ bụrụ na ị zutere nsogbu, rụtụ aka na usoro nchọpụta nsogbu ndị a na-emekarị:
- Enweghị mmepụta ihe ngosi:
- Hụ na eriri ihe nlele ahụ jikọtara nke ọma na kaadị eserese na ihe nlele ahụ.
- Verify the monitor is set to the correct input source.
- Check if the graphics card is fully seated in its PCIe slot.
- If applicable, ensure all PCIe power connectors are securely attached.
- Jiri nlele ma ọ bụ eriri dị iche nwalee ma ọ ga-ekwe omume.
- Okwu ndị ọkwọ ụgbọ ala:
- Reinstall the latest drivers from the NVIDIA websaịtị.
- Try rolling back to a previous driver version if issues started after an update.
- Use Display Driver Uninstaller (DDU) in Safe Mode to completely remove old drivers before installing new ones.
- Performance Problems (Low FPS, Stuttering):
- Gbaa mbọ hụ na ndị ọkwọ ụgbọala emelitere.
- Check for overheating using monitoring software (e.g., MSI Afterburner, HWMonitor). Clean dust if necessary.
- Verify that your system meets the minimum requirements for the applications or games you are running.
- Check power supply unit (PSU) wattage; an insufficient PSU can cause performance issues.
- System Instability (Crashes, Blue Screens):
- Check for driver conflicts or corruption.
- Monitor temperatures to rule out overheating.
- Ensure the graphics card is properly seated and secured.
